Intake Manifold -- Inspection |
1. INSPECT NO. 1 INTAKE MANIFOLD FOR FLATNESS |
Using a precision straightedge and feeler gauge, measure the warpage of the contact surface between the No. 1 and No. 3 intake manifold, and the No. 1 intake manifold and cylinder head.
- Maximum Warpage:
Item
| Specified Condition
|
No. 3 intake manifold
| 0.10 mm (0.00394 in.)
|
Cylinder head
| 0.10 mm (0.00394 in.)
|
If the warpage is more than the maximum, replace the No. 1 intake manifold.
2. INSPECT NO. 2 INTAKE MANIFOLD FOR FLATNESS |
Using a precision straightedge and feeler gauge, measure the warpage of the contact surface between the No. 2 and No. 3 intake manifold, and the No. 2 intake manifold and cylinder head.
- Maximum Warpage:
Item
| Specified Condition
|
No. 3 intake manifold
| 0.10 mm (0.00394 in.)
|
Cylinder head
| 0.10 mm (0.00394 in.)
|
If the warpage is more than the maximum, replace the No. 2 intake manifold.
3. INSPECT NO. 3 INTAKE MANIFOLD FOR FLATNESS |
Using a precision straightedge and feeler gauge, measure the warpage of the contact surface between the No. 3 and No. 1 intake manifold, the No. 3 and No. 2 intake manifold, and the No. 3 intake manifold and intake pipe.
- Maximum Warpage:
Item
| Specified Condition
|
Intake pipe
| 0.10 mm (0.00394 in.)
|
No. 2 and No. 3 intake manifold
| 0.15 mm (0.00591 in.)
|
If the warpage is more than the maximum, replace the No. 3 intake manifold.
